Output 23a998d134fe13cad60922250e1268c12b60a86f6da9f6e02cddfa182897ca14:0

value
158110015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a44f0c429874cf656adc7149f8e050aa6b9c8fd OP_EQUAL
address
3CqWx1unZKXHtpqP5qZzTBTPVcF29g4Tx7
transaction
23a998d134fe13cad60922250e1268c12b60a86f6da9f6e02cddfa182897ca14
confirmations
269084
spent
true